Cutting-Edge Surgical Equipment: Advancing Patient Care
Surgical technology has undergone a remarkable transformation in recent years, leading to significant improvements in patient care. State-of-the-art surgical equipment is now equipped with advanced features that enhance precision, less invasive techniques, and overall patient outcomes.
One key breakthrough is the use of robotic-assisted surgery. These systems provide surgeons with enhanced dexterity, visualization, and control, leading to miniature incisions, reduced blood loss, and faster recovery times. Furthermore, advancements in imaging technology, such as 3D imaging and intraoperative ultrasound, allow for more accurate diagnoses and surgical planning.
Additionally, the development of new materials and instruments has improved various surgical specialties. For example, biocompatible implants and tissue adhesives are now widely used to repair damaged tissues with greater success rates.

Sterilization and Safety Protocols for Medical Devices
Ensuring the sterility and safety of medical devices is paramount essential to patient well-being and reducing the risk of healthcare-associated infections. Stringent sterilization protocols must be followed throughout the entire lifecycle of a medical device, from production to disposal. These protocols involve a variety of methods, including steam sterilization, ethylene oxide gas sterilization, and dry heat sterilization, each suited for specific types of devices. Moreover, strict safety protocols are required to guarantee that medical devices are operating correctly and free from issues. Regular inspections, testing, and maintenance are integral components of these safety protocols.
- Adherence to established sterilization and safety guidelines is mandated by regulatory bodies such as the FDA and ISO.
- Medical professionals play a key role in preserving the sterility and safety of medical devices through proper handling, storage, and usage practices.
Technology's Influence on Smart Medical Devices
Smart medical devices are revolutionizing healthcare by leveraging cutting-edge technology to enhance patient care and improve diagnostic accuracy. These intelligent systems harness various technological advancements, such as artificial intelligence (AI), machine learning, and the Internet of Things (IoT), to provide real-time monitoring, facilitate personalized treatment plans, and improve clinical workflows.
- AI algorithms can analyze patient data, detecting patterns and anomalies that may indicate potential health issues.
- Furthermore smart medical devices can gather vast amounts of patient information, enabling doctors to arrive at more informed decisions.
- The integration of IoT technology allows for remote patient monitoring, enabling timely interventions and boosting overall health outcomes.
As technology continues to advance, smart medical equipment will play an increasingly crucial role in shaping the future of healthcare, leading to a more productive and patient-centered system.
